To cause disease, pathogenic bacteria must overcome host innate immune barriers to infection. Interferon
gamma (IFNy) and t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NFa) are cytokines produced both early and later in the
immune response. Early production of these cytokines rapidly activates inflammatory responses to serve as
a first line of defense against invading bacteria. We and other labs have found that Francisella tularensis and
Burkholderia pseudomallei interfere with NFicB activation (causing reduced production of TNFa) and with the
response of infected cells to IFNy. We hypothesize that subversion of these defense pathways involves
specific pathogen gene products ("effectors") and promotes infection and disease caused by these category
A and B cytosolic bacterial pathogens. We have developed novel screening technologies to identify the
Francisella tularensis and Burkholderia pseudomallei gene products responsible for their subversion of host
IFNy and NFicB responses. Effector proteins identified in our screens will be studied for their contributions to
immune subversion and disease in infected animals. We will also dissect their mechanisms of action and
develop assays that will facilitate screening for inhibitors of their functions. These studies will thus lay the
foundation for future work to therapeutically impair establishment of F. tularensis and B. pseudomallei
infections. Our Specific Aims are:
(1) Identify F. tularensis and B. pseudomallei gene products interfering with innate immune responses.
(2) Engineer mutant F. tularensis and B. pseudomallei strains deficient for putative immune-suppressive
genes and test the effects of such mutations on virulence in mouse infection models.
(3) Identify the stage in the macrophage response to IFNy that is impaired by infection with F. tularensis.
We will use novel reagents and new technologies to identify novel therapeutic targets and attenuated
vaccine strains in F. tularensis and B. pseudomallei. Further, by demonstrating how these technologies can
be applied, our studies may ultimately promote the identification and therapeutic targeting of immune
